مشكلات تحميل مشروع React Native في بناء التطوير
مقدمة
تعتبر تقنية React Native واحدة من أكثر الأدوات شعبية لتطوير تطبيقات الهواتف المحمولة. ومع ذلك، قد يواجه المبرمجون مشكلات مختلفة أثناء العمل على مشاريعهم، ومن بينها مشكلة تحميل المشروع. في هذا المقال، سنستعرض مشكلة تظهر عادةً في عملية تطوير التطبيقات باستخدام React Native، تحديدًا الرسالة التي تنص على "حدثت مشكلة أثناء تحميل المشروع. واجه بناء التطوير هذا الخطأ التالي." وسنبحث في الأسباب المحتملة لهذه المشكلة وطرق حلها.
أسباب المشكلة
عندما تتلقى رسالة الخطأ "حدثت مشكلة أثناء تحميل المشروع"، يمكن أن تكون الأسباب متعددة. تشير الرسالة إلى أن ViewManagerResolver أرجع قيمة فارغة لـ RNSVGPath أو RCTRNSVGPath. هذه المشكلة ترتبط عادةً بالإعدادات أو المكونات المستخدمة في تطبيقك. قد تكون هناك تعارضات بين المكتبات أو عدم توافق بين إصدارات React Native والمكتبات الأخرى التي تستخدمها. إن عدم وجود المكون المناسب أو الخلط بين الإصدارات يمكن أن يؤدي إلى هذه الأنواع من الأخطاء.
التأكد من الإعدادات
أول خطوة يجب اتخاذها هي التأكد من أن جميع المكتبات والإصدارات متوافقة مع إصدار React Native الذي تستخدمه. عليك بمراجعة ملف package.json الخاص بمشروعك والتأكد من أن جميع الاعتمادات (dependencies) متوافقة. بعد ذلك، تأكد أن لديك أحدث تحديثات للمكتبات التي تستعملها. يمكنك استخدام الأمر npm outdated
أو yarn outdated
للتحقق من المكتبات التي تحتاج إلى تحديث.
إعادة بناء المشروع
إذا قمت بتحديث المكتبات وتأكدت من توافقها، فقد تحتاج إلى إعادة بناء المشروع. في بعض الأحيان، تبقى بعض الملفات مؤقتة في النظام وتسبب تعارضات. عليك بإيقاف تشغيل التطبيق وإعادة تشغيله. جرب استخدام الأوامر التالية:
npm start --reset-cache
أو إذا كنت تستخدم Expo:
expo start -c
هذه الأوامر ستقوم بإعادة تعيين ذاكرة التخزين المؤقت، مما قد يحل مشكلتك.
الحلول البديلة والإصلاحات
إذا استمرت المشكلة، يمكن أن تفكر في استخدام حلول بديلة. على سبيل المثال، يمكنك تجربة إنشاء مشروع جديد وتطبيق الإعدادات اللازمة ثم إضافة المكونات واحدًا تلو الآخر للتأكد من المكون الذي يسَبب الخطأ. هذا سيساعدك في عزل المشكلة وتحديد كيف يمكنك إصلاحها.
بالإضافة إلى ذلك، تحقق من ملفات الأكواد الخاصة بك. قد يكون ترتيب المكونات أو استخدام مكونات غير متوافقة أو عدم استيراد الملفات بشكل صحيح هو السبب وراء هذه المشكلة. تأكد من اتباع التوجيهات الصحيحة في الوثائق الرسمية لـ React Native.
استشارة المجتمع
لا تتردد في الاستعانة بالمجتمع عبر الإنترنت. توجد العديد من المنتديات والمجموعات الخاصة بـ React Native حيث يمكنك طرح سؤالك. الخبرات السابقة لأعضاء المجتمع يمكن أن تقدم لك حلولًا فعالة.
الخاتمة
في الختام، تعتبر مشكلة "حدثت مشكلة أثناء تحميل المشروع. واجه بناء التطوير هذا الخطأ التالي" متكررة بين المطورين عند استخدام React Native. عن طريق اتخاذ الخطوات اللازمة مثل تحديث المكتبات، إعادة بناء المشروع، والتحقق من الإعدادات، يمكنك التغلب على هذه المشكلة. تذكر أن التواصل مع المجتمع يمكن أن يوفر لك الدعم الذي تحتاجه لحل أي تحديات تواجهها. تذكر، التحديات جزء من العملية التطويرية، ومع الوقت ستصبح أكثر مهارة في التعامل معها.